• linkedu视频
  • 平面设计
  • 电脑入门
  • 操作系统
  • 办公应用
  • 电脑硬件
  • 动画设计
  • 3D设计
  • 网页设计
  • CAD设计
  • 影音处理
  • 数据库
  • 程序设计
  • 认证考试
  • 信息管理
  • 信息安全
菜单
linkedu.com
  • 网页制作
  • 数据库
  • 程序设计
  • 操作系统
  • CMS教程
  • 游戏攻略
  • 脚本语言
  • 平面设计
  • 软件教程
  • 网络安全
  • 电脑知识
  • 服务器
  • 视频教程
  • JavaScript
  • ASP.NET
  • PHP
  • 正则表达式
  • AJAX
  • JSP
  • ASP
  • Flex
  • XML
  • 编程技巧
  • Android
  • swift
  • C#教程
  • vb
  • vb.net
  • C语言
  • Java
  • Delphi
  • 易语言
  • vc/mfc
  • 嵌入式开发
  • 游戏开发
  • ios
  • 编程问答
  • 汇编语言
  • 微信小程序
  • 数据结构
  • OpenGL
  • 架构设计
  • qt
  • 微信公众号
您的位置:首页 > 程序设计 >JavaScript > JS日期格式化

JS日期格式化

作者:xqnode 字体:[增加 减小] 来源:互联网 时间:2017-09-18

xqnode通过本文主要向大家介绍了javascript等相关知识,希望对您有所帮助,也希望大家支持linkedu.com www.linkedu.com
//时间格式化函数
Date.prototype.format = function (format) {
    var o = {
        "M+": this.getMonth() + 1, //month
        "d+": this.getDate(), //day
        "H+": this.getHours(), //hour
        "m+": this.getMinutes(), //minute
        "s+": this.getSeconds(), //second
        "q+": Math.floor((this.getMonth() + 3) / 3), //quarter
        "S": this.getMilliseconds() //millisecond
    }
    if (/(y+)/.test(format)) format = format.replace(RegExp.$1,(this.getFullYear() + "").substr(4 - RegExp.$1.length));
    for (var k in o) if (new RegExp("(" + k + ")").test(format))format = format.replace(RegExp.$1,RegExp.$1.length == 1 ? o[k] :("00" + o[k]).substr(("" + o[k]).length));
    return format;
}

使用:

new Date().format('yyyy-MM-dd HH:mm:ss');
分享到:QQ空间新浪微博腾讯微博微信百度贴吧QQ好友复制网址打印

您可能想查找下面的文章:

相关文章

  • 2017-05-11angularjs实现的前端分页控件示例
  • 2017-05-11基于Bootstrap框架实现图片切换
  • 2017-05-11jQuery.Validate表单验证插件的使用示例详解
  • 2017-05-11js实现随机抽选效果、随机抽选红色球效果
  • 2017-05-11详解JS异步加载的三种方式
  • 2017-05-11利用transition实现文字上下抖动的效果
  • 2017-05-11如何解决vue与传统jquery插件冲突
  • 2017-05-11js模拟支付宝密码输入框
  • 2017-05-11JS简单实现点击按钮或文字显示遮罩层的方法
  • 2017-05-11nodejs入门教程四:URL相关模块用法分析

文章分类

  • JavaScript
  • ASP.NET
  • PHP
  • 正则表达式
  • AJAX
  • JSP
  • ASP
  • Flex
  • XML
  • 编程技巧
  • Android
  • swift
  • C#教程
  • vb
  • vb.net
  • C语言
  • Java
  • Delphi
  • 易语言
  • vc/mfc
  • 嵌入式开发
  • 游戏开发
  • ios
  • 编程问答
  • 汇编语言
  • 微信小程序
  • 数据结构
  • OpenGL
  • 架构设计
  • qt
  • 微信公众号

最近更新的内容

    • JavaScript中双符号的运算详解
    • 利用vue.js插入dom节点的方法
    • 详解RequireJS按需加载样式文件
    • Bootstrap中data-target 到底是什么
    • angularjs指令之绑定策略(@、=、&)
    • Angular.js与node.js项目里用cookie校验账户登录详解
    • js DOM BOM基础操作
    • 微信小程序 实战程序简易新闻的制作
    • HTML中使背景图片自适应浏览器大小实例详解
    • JavaScript中双向数据绑定详解

关于我们 - 联系我们 - 免责声明 - 网站地图

©2020-2025 All Rights Reserved. linkedu.com 版权所有